Transaction 72efee607c83c3eece4a51bc69e29489084c4037a03502b96dce81c0ec80bde0

1 Input
2 Outputs
  • 72efee607c83c3eece4a51bc69e29489084c4037a03502b96dce81c0ec80bde0:0
  • value  711440
    address  36336MBHcQ5WYJfjcjd9rswmrKzrpboV9w
  • 72efee607c83c3eece4a51bc69e29489084c4037a03502b96dce81c0ec80bde0:1
  • value  87516
    address  14MPM7sszM4SuH4gPmtygKfvvW8U3Y2DYQ